Dixon on coaches’ All-State first team

The Illinois Basketball Coaches Association recognized five local players on its Class 3A/4A All-State Girls Basketball teams Friday.

Johnsburg senior guard Melissa Dixon was named to the IBCA’s All-State first team, and Cary-Grove senior forward Claire Jakubicek was named to the second team.

C-G senior guard Megan Straumann and Hampshire senior forward Alex Dumoulin were selected to the fourth team. C-G junior guard Paige Lincicum and C-G sophomore forward Olivia Jakubicek received special mentions.

Vilardo, two Gators honored: The Chicago Metropolitan Hockey League Central Division announced its award winners for the 2010-11 season.

Cary-Grove’s Mike Vilardo was named Player of the Year. He led the division in scoring.

Crystal Lake South’s Brian Lichterman won the Leadership Award, and Jack Willet won the Academic and Community Service Award.

Van Dorin misses three-point title repeat: Hampshire senior basketball player Jessie Van Dorin finished fourth in the IHSA Class 3A Three-Point Showdown on Friday at Illinois State University’s Redbird Arena. Van Dorin, the defending Class 3A champion, hit 7 of 15 shots.

Illiana Christian’s Erinn Behn made 10 to win the title.
